Food for People, Not for Profit: A Source Book on the Food Crisis

Rate this book
Looks at the adverse political, environmental, and nutritional impact of the food industry as well as detailing the ways in which the American consumer is being exploited. Bibliogs

466 pages, Mass Market Paperback

First published March 12, 1975
